For smooth sport flying at around 2100 rpm they should be fine.
Just for fun I flew an old set of Turnigy 4000mAh 40C packs through my Goblin 700 on Friday morning. I went easy on them, very smooth collective management, etc and put 2200 mAh back into them after 4:15 at 2100 rpm headspeed. They came down cool and I'm planning on extending my timer to 5 minutes next time I fly them.
